Sponge cake is a very classic cake. This sponge cake adopts the egg separation method, adding aromatic coffee and cocoa powder. The flavor is mellow, the texture is soft and delicate, and it is very delicious. This style can also use 8-inch cake Mold to bake. "

Tips:

The egg separation method eliminates the need to soak the egg bowl in warm water, which makes it less difficult to beat. Cocoa powder and low-gluten flour are treated separately, and the cocoa powder, coffee, and melted butter are mixed and stirred in advance to avoid defoaming caused by large cocoa powder particles. When turning the cake batter, the movement should be gentle and the correct mixing technique must be adopted.
